MARRIAGE

07/09/20 • 27 min

Dr. Kim and Colby Leadership Podcast

In this episode, Colby & Dr. Kim talk about why marriage is so important even when it isn’t always fun or easy, they share personal stories from their own experiences, and give advice on how you can make your marriage better today.

Quotes:

  • “I’ve grown and learned the most in the times when my marriage has been tough.” - Colby Taylor
  • “Marriage isn’t always walking along a rosy path but if you have Jesus with you through the hard times you will come out on the other side.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“The best marriages are the marriages that have God at the center.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“Marriage is meant to last a lifetime.” - Colby Taylor
  • “It’s good for married couples to go to weddings and funerals together.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“Premarital counseling reduces the divorce rate by 50%.” - Colby Taylor
  • “If God can change a Saul into Paul, I believe he can do the same thing with marriages.” - Colby Taylor

Healthy Sex in Marriage

In this episode, Colby & Dr. Kim talk about why sex in marriage is the best sex, how to not let past sexual baggage define you, and how to improve your sex life for both you and your spouse.

Quotes:

  • “God made our bodies fit together in the way they do, He created our bodies and He created sex.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“The longer you are married to someone and the more you know them and understand them, the better your sex life becomes.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“I pray every day that my sexual desire is for my wife only and God honors that prayer.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“Let God redefine your sexual past for you.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“We are meant to be in an intimate relationship with one person, that is what we desire and crave.” - Colby Taylor
  • “You have to talk about sex in your marriage.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ling

Homework Questions:

  1. Do you talk with your wife about sex?
  2. Do you communicate your desires to your wife? Do you listen when she communicates her desires to you?
  3. Do you know what turns your wife on? Do you do it?
  4. How often do you expect to have sex? Is that realistic considering the stage of life you are in?
  5. Do you believe that your past sexual experiences can affect intimacy with your wife?
  6. What was your view of sex growing up?
  7. Did you have any misconceptions about what sex would be like in marriage? What were they?
  8. Who are other men who you can be open with about topics like sex? Is there a group you need to join? A friend you need to reach out to?

Ego

In this episode, Colby & Dr. Kim talk about and define having a healthy ego versus a “big” ego. They answer the question, is having an ego always a bad thing? They discuss ways to find healthy balance in your life, how to learn from your mistakes, and signs that your ego might be out of control.

Quotes:

  • “Sometimes you don’t notice how much of your ego is controlling aspects of who you are.” - Colby Taylor
  • “My ego doesn’t want me to take responsibility for my actions, it makes me want to feel like I’m better than I am and blame others for my mistakes.” - Colby Taylor
  • “Having an ego becomes dangerous when you are not willing to learn from the mistakes that you make.” - Colby Taylor
  • “If you aren’t growing, you are going backwards.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“When you get older there is a tendency to start thinking that you know more than you do and to stop learning and growing.” - Colby Taylor
  • “I don’t usually see the guy with the bad ego in counseling, I see the coworkers of the guy with the bad ego in counseling, who don’t know how to work with someone who thinks they are right all the time.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“Humility is the template you want to lay over your life.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ling
  • “You never have to feel bad about your failures or mistakes if you let God use them.” - Dr. Kim Kimberling

Homework Questions:

  1. What does ego look like in your life?
  2. In what ways is your ego good / bad?
  3. Are there any areas where your ego is out of control?
  4. How can you better control your ego?
  5. Do you see any areas where your ego has negatively affected others?
  6. Who can you ask to help you see areas where your ego needs to be checked?
